Vestige

Group Exhibition

3 - 29 August 2021

Address:
Tirtodipuran Link Building A
Jl. Tirtodipuran No 50
Yogyakarta, Indonesia

Written by Wahyudin

Consisting of 15 works—14 paintings and 1 drawing-relief—from 11 Indonesian artists across generations who live and work in Yogyakarta, Bali, and Jakarta, Vestige aims to present works of art that reflect the processes or forms of change.


Vestige means faded trace of what has passed. The exhibition offers an opportunity to pay attention to changes and new habits that have emerged from an uncertain period. Featuring works by Agus TBR, Entang Wiharso, Galam Zulkifli, Galih Reza Suseno, Heri Dono, Ida Bagus Putu Purwa, Jumaldi Alfi, Kemalezedine, Nano Warsono, Ronald Manullang, and Ugo Untoro, each will present works as a form of assessment of the causal relationship between the pandemic period that has been experienced and its influence on the artists' thinking and working patterns.
